Output c745dda734737f8a478fafe68dc03a7dacaa0457dddf5ee342e802e8dce609ea:59

value
50628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f375862d925bb7df6fdccfa5e7697863bd37bb OP_EQUAL
address
3BzFFrxMcM1BCyJbfuiGgRCtcNcwiSWuru
transaction
c745dda734737f8a478fafe68dc03a7dacaa0457dddf5ee342e802e8dce609ea
confirmations
281640
spent
true